Fixed bug #1011 Daniel Ellis 2010-06-25 15:20:31 PDT SDL based applications sometimes display the wrong application name in the Sound Preferences dialog when using pulseaudio. I can see from the code that the SDL pulse module is initiating a new pulse audio context and passing an application name using the function get_progname(). The get_progname() function returns the name of the current process. However, the process name is often not a suitable name to use. For example, the OpenShot video editor is a python application, and so "python" is displayed in the Sound Preferences window (see Bug #596504), when it should be displaying "OpenShot". PulseAudio allows applications to specify the application name, either at the time the context is created (as SDL does currently), or by special environment variables (see http://www.pulseaudio.org/wiki/ApplicationProperties). If no name is specified, then pulseaudio will determine the name based on the process. If you specify the application name when initiating the pulseaudio context, then that will override any application name specified using an environment variable. As libsdl is a library, I believe the solution is for libsdl to not specify any application name when initiating a pulseaudio context, which will enable applications to specify the application name using environment variables. In the case that the applications do not specify anything, pulseaudio will fall back to using the process name anyway. The attached patch removes the get_progname() function and passes NULL as the application name when creating the pulseaudio context, which fixes the issue.

#include "SDL_config.h"

/* Allow access to the audio stream on BeOS */

#include <SoundPlayer.h>

#include "../../main/beos/SDL_BeApp.h"

extern "C"
{

#include "SDL_audio.h"
#include "../SDL_audio_c.h"
#include "../SDL_sysaudio.h"
#include "../../thread/beos/SDL_systhread_c.h"
#include "SDL_beaudio.h"

}


/* !!! FIXME: have the callback call the higher level to avoid code dupe. */
/* The BeOS callback for handling the audio buffer */
static void
FillSound(void *device, void *stream, size_t len,
          const media_raw_audio_format & format)
{
    SDL_AudioDevice *audio = (SDL_AudioDevice *) device;

    /* Silence the buffer, since it's ours */
    SDL_memset(stream, audio->spec.silence, len);

    /* Only do soemthing if audio is enabled */
    if (!audio->enabled)
        return;

    if (!audio->paused) {
        if (audio->convert.needed) {
            SDL_mutexP(audio->mixer_lock);
            (*audio->spec.callback) (audio->spec.userdata,
                                     (Uint8 *) audio->convert.buf,
                                     audio->convert.len);
            SDL_mutexV(audio->mixer_lock);
            SDL_ConvertAudio(&audio->convert);
            SDL_memcpy(stream, audio->convert.buf, audio->convert.len_cvt);
        } else {
            SDL_mutexP(audio->mixer_lock);
            (*audio->spec.callback) (audio->spec.userdata,
                                     (Uint8 *) stream, len);
            SDL_mutexV(audio->mixer_lock);
        }
    }
}

static void
BEOSAUDIO_CloseDevice(_THIS)
{
    if (_this->hidden != NULL) {
        if (_this->hidden->audio_obj) {
            _this->hidden->audio_obj->Stop();
            delete _this->hidden->audio_obj;
            _this->hidden->audio_obj = NULL;
        }

        delete _this->hidden;
        _this->hidden = NULL;
    }
}

static int
BEOSAUDIO_OpenDevice(_THIS, const char *devname, int iscapture)
{
    int valid_datatype = 0;
    media_raw_audio_format format;
    SDL_AudioFormat test_format = SDL_FirstAudioFormat(_this->spec.format);

    /* Initialize all variables that we clean on shutdown */
    _this->hidden = new SDL_PrivateAudioData;
    if (_this->hidden == NULL) {
        SDL_OutOfMemory();
        return 0;
    }
    SDL_memset(_this->hidden, 0, (sizeof *_this->hidden));

    /* Parse the audio format and fill the Be raw audio format */
    SDL_memset(&format, '\0', sizeof(media_raw_audio_format));
    format.byte_order = B_MEDIA_LITTLE_ENDIAN;
    format.frame_rate = (float) _this->spec.freq;
    format.channel_count = _this->spec.channels;        /* !!! FIXME: support > 2? */
    while ((!valid_datatype) && (test_format)) {
        valid_datatype = 1;
        _this->spec.format = test_format;
        switch (test_format) {
        case AUDIO_S8:
            format.format = media_raw_audio_format::B_AUDIO_CHAR;
            break;

        case AUDIO_U8:
            format.format = media_raw_audio_format::B_AUDIO_UCHAR;
            break;

        case AUDIO_S16LSB:
            format.format = media_raw_audio_format::B_AUDIO_SHORT;
            break;

        case AUDIO_S16MSB:
            format.format = media_raw_audio_format::B_AUDIO_SHORT;
            format.byte_order = B_MEDIA_BIG_ENDIAN;
            break;

        case AUDIO_S32LSB:
            format.format = media_raw_audio_format::B_AUDIO_INT;
            break;

        case AUDIO_S32MSB:
            format.format = media_raw_audio_format::B_AUDIO_INT;
            format.byte_order = B_MEDIA_BIG_ENDIAN;
            break;

        case AUDIO_F32LSB:
            format.format = media_raw_audio_format::B_AUDIO_FLOAT;
            break;

        case AUDIO_F32MSB:
            format.format = media_raw_audio_format::B_AUDIO_FLOAT;
            format.byte_order = B_MEDIA_BIG_ENDIAN;
            break;

        default:
            valid_datatype = 0;
            test_format = SDL_NextAudioFormat();
            break;
        }
    }

    format.buffer_size = _this->spec.samples;

    if (!valid_datatype) {      /* shouldn't happen, but just in case... */
        BEOSAUDIO_CloseDevice(_this);
        SDL_SetError("Unsupported audio format");
        return 0;
    }

    /* Calculate the final parameters for this audio specification */
    SDL_CalculateAudioSpec(&_this->spec);

    /* Subscribe to the audio stream (creates a new thread) */
    sigset_t omask;
    SDL_MaskSignals(&omask);
    _this->hidden->audio_obj = new BSoundPlayer(&format, "SDL Audio",
                                                FillSound, NULL, _this);
    SDL_UnmaskSignals(&omask);

    if (_this->hidden->audio_obj->Start() == B_NO_ERROR) {
        _this->hidden->audio_obj->SetHasData(true);
    } else {
        BEOSAUDIO_CloseDevice(_this);
        SDL_SetError("Unable to start Be audio");
        return 0;
    }

    /* We're running! */
    return 1;
}

static void
BEOSAUDIO_Deinitialize(void)
{
    SDL_QuitBeApp();
}

static int
BEOSAUDIO_Init(SDL_AudioDriverImpl * impl)
{
    /* Initialize the Be Application, if it's not already started */
    if (SDL_InitBeApp() < 0) {
        return 0;
    }

    /* Set the function pointers */
    impl->OpenDevice = BEOSAUDIO_OpenDevice;
    impl->CloseDevice = BEOSAUDIO_CloseDevice;
    impl->Deinitialize = BEOSAUDIO_Deinitialize;
    impl->ProvidesOwnCallbackThread = 1;
    impl->OnlyHasDefaultOutputDevice = 1;

    return 1;   /* this audio target is available. */
}

extern "C"
{
    extern AudioBootStrap BEOSAUDIO_bootstrap;
}
AudioBootStrap BEOSAUDIO_bootstrap = {
    "baudio", "BeOS BSoundPlayer", BEOSAUDIO_Init, 0
};
